Diversification is becoming an important part of business throughout the construction industry and across all sectors. It helps to maintain businesses during periods of crisis, spreads risk across many projects, and helps to create additional revenue streams. To succeed, it is essential to develop a diversification strategy. The strategy should include new target sectors, new positions for staff, and ensuring compliance.

Using machine learning in construction can help reduce risks and improve the design and construction process. Machine learning can also help to improve quality, automate processes, and reduce administrative burdens.
Machine learning is also able to make educated predictions. These predictions can be used to increase the productivity of contracting companies and improve product availability.
Machine learning is also able to detect trends in data. It can notify users of updates and make informed predictions that help to streamline workflows.
Using machine learning in construction can help to reduce the risk of rework and improve safety. It can also alert project leaders of critical issues and provide insight into what might be a possible hazard.
Other advantages of using machine learning include a reduced administrative burden and improved productivity. By integrating technology systems, more companies will benefit from machine learning. This will also lead to an increased supply of integrated data that will help the industry to move forward.
